I am Mary Constance Fishback, owner and principal designer of Camellia Design Studio. I thrive on creating unique interiors and love finding that perfect balance between traditional and modern - designs that feel fresh, relevant, and timeless all at once.

My work is all about thoughtful curation. I have a deep appreciation for mixing meaningful heirloom pieces with amazing new finds, and I’m passionate about designing spaces that truly reflect my clients—their personalities, their style, and how they want to live. I always go the extra mile to make sure every finish and detail feels just right.

I grew up near Syracuse, New York and moved to Gaithersburg, Maryland over 30 years ago. I live with my husband Dave and our lovable golden retriever, Sugar.

 

Interior design has been a lifelong love of mine, but I actually started my career in the corporate world, working in contract management.

After many years, I decided to finally follow my passion and enrolled in the interior design program at Montgomery College. I took classes at night and on weekends while working full-time and finished my studies just one month after retiring. That same month, I launched Camellia Design Studio—and I’ve never looked back. I feel incredibly lucky and grateful every day to be doing work that I truly love, helping people create homes that they love coming home to.
